Definitely best Pizza in town! Unfortunately the place hasn´t a web-address, so I´m not able to provide pictures. It´s a little Italian punk-rock-pizzeria. No pseudo-oh sole mio-shit… Service is sometimes rude, you might even have to wait a while – but believe me, it´s worth it! Just google “Il casolare” and you´ll find just positive critics. They serve aswell other food but that´s not why you´d go there. Many places in Berlin try to copy them but they don´t have it. Not the real thing… The statements of satisfied customers are written literally all over the walls in Il Casolare. Bands like “The Rasmus” left they comments and more.  So, check it out:

Il Casolare, Grimmstraße 30, 10967 Berlin Kreuzberg, Tel: +4930-69506610

Make reservations otherwise it´s probably too crowded to get a table!

Funnily enough the best place in Berlin to eat Thai-food is not even a Thai-restaurant. It´s actually a Cocktail-bar but you get much, much more… They serve great breakfast and Thai-food. Aswell the drinks are fine. Everything used is extremely fresh – a difference that really matters. You just taste it! So check out:

Mutter, Hohenstaufenstr. 4, 10781 Berlin, Tel:  +4930/ 2164990

If the smoother tunes are more what you dig, try “Quasimodo”. They have a great Jazz-program and the nicest atmosphere. On Wednesdays after midnight the stage is open to anyone and often these are the most exciting evenings. The crowed is wildly mixed: young students order their beers next to the old connoisseur, who likes his wine. Not too posh, not too trashy – a place open to anyone who likes Jazz.
